Since currencies work different than stocks do, so if you are used to mutual funds or stocks, this may be a little confusing when you first get started.  Stocks are based on how a company is doing, whereas currencies are based on how a country is doing in comparison to another company.  This is what mainly separates currencies from most other types of trading or investments.   If one currency is valued higher, then there is another currency that is going to be valued at a lesser rate.

In this type on investing, you will compare how other countries are doing in the rest of the world.  Stocks are only open for trade during business hours on Wall Street, but currencies can be traded any time of the day since they are based on countries that may be in other time zones.  When investing currencies, you have to determine which countries currency will be valued higher than another.  As it is with many other investments, you want to buy at a lower price and sell at a higher price.
